TeXovani ciziho zdroje?
Zdenek Wagner
wagner at cesnet.cz
Fri Jul 4 11:47:00 CEST 2003
On Fri, 4 Jul 2003, David Necas (Yeti) wrote:
>
> \expandafter\let\csname BFLMPSVZ\endcsname\input
> \let\input\relax
> \long\def\incdoc{\let\aftergroup\relax
> \let\futurelet\relax
> \let\incdoc\relax
> \csname BFLMPSVZ\endcsname UZIVATELUV_DOKUMENT.tex
> }
> \expandafter{\expandafter\incdoc}
> \expandafter\let\expandafter\input\csname BFLMPSVZ\endcsname
>
> kde BFLMPSVZ je dostatecne nahodny a s nicim nekolidujici
> retezec.
>
Kdyz se pouzije generator nahodnych cisel a vytvori se neco jako
\csname .2187534343436753464\endcsname, tak to urcite s nicim kolidovat
nebude.
> Konstrukce s \expandafter u \incdoc je nutna kvuli
> moznemu predefinovani } utocnikem na aktivni znak, coz by mu
> umoznilo predefinovat si cokoli, co by nasel za }.
>
> Doufam, ze uzivatele nebudou potrebovat \aftergroup
> a \futurelet, protoze se mi zda, ze by to s jejich pomoci
> asi slo obejit, dokonce i bez znalosti, jak wrapper vypada.
>
> Je mozne, ze jde obejit i tohle, nebo ze to jde udelat
> i lepe, ale zatim jsem nevymyslel jak.
>
> Yeti
>
> --
> DPM 5.7.2: Do not use tab characters. Their effect is not predictable.
>
Zdenek Wagner
e-mail: wagner at cesnet.cz
see also http://hroch486.icpf.cas.cz/wagner/
http://icebearsoft.euweb.cz
More information about the csTeX
mailing list